SIMLIFE: Pattern Understanding for Long-Horizon Human-Agent Partnership
arXiv cs.AIen
arXiv:2609.19610v1 Announce Type: new Abstract: Understanding humans over long horizons requires agents to infer not only what people need in the moment, but also how routines form, why they repeat, and when they change. We introduce SimLife, a scalable platform for simulating long-term household life with rich visual observations, ground-truth action logs, and synthetic dialogues with audio. Built on SimLife, SimLife-BP evaluates long-context pattern understanding: the ability to infer latent behavioral rules from weeks or months of everyday observations.
